Abstract

We investigate a second order elliptic differential operator $A_{\beta, \mu}$ on a bounded, open set $\Omega\subset\mathbb{R}^{d}$ with Lipschitz boundary subject to a nonlocal boundary condition of Robin type. More precisely we have $0\leq \beta\in L^{\infty}(\partial\Omega)$ and $\mu\colon\partial\Omega\to{\mathscr{M}}(\overline{\Omega})$, and boundary conditions of the form $$ \partial_{\nu}^{{\mathscr{A}}}u(z)+\beta(z)u(z)=\int_{\overline{\Omega}}u(x)\mu(z)(\mathrm{d}x), \quad z\in\partial\Omega, $$ where $\partial_{\nu}^{{\mathscr{A}}}$ denotes the weak conormal derivative with respect to our differential operator. Under suitable conditions on the coefficients of the differential operator and the function $\mu$ we show that $A_{\beta, \mu}$ generates a holomorphic semigroup $T_{\beta,\mu}$ on $L^{\infty}(\Omega)$ which enjoys the strong Feller property. In particular, it takes values in $C(\overline{\Omega})$. Its restriction to $C(\overline{\Omega})$ is strongly continuous and holomorphic. We also establish positivity and contractivity of the semigroup under additional assumptions and study the asymptotic behavior of the semigroup.
